Waste Pro of Florida Acquires Two Properties for $12 Milion in Effort to Consolidate Operations

According to area deeds, Waste Pro of Florida has acquired two properties in Pinellas Park for a combined $12.1 million.

Waste Pro of Florida, one of Central Florida's largest private companies, purchased the area from AAA Service Co., a local demolition company. According to a company spokesperson, Waste Pro plans to consolidate its Pinellas County operations at this new site. The company did not say what it plans to do with its current facility in Clearwater, Fla.

According to Pinellas County property records, the new area, an 11.82-acre site, was classified as vacant industrial land. Previously the site was home to Weintraub Recycling, the concrete recycling division of AAA Service Co.
